HCPCS Q5102

What is HCPCS Q5102?

HCPCS Healthcare Service

Plain-English Explanation

HCPCS Q5102 represents inj., infliximab biosimilar. This hcpcs is commonly used in healthcare billing and represents a specific medical service or procedure.

Description: Inj., infliximab biosimilar
